Understanding Emergency Electrician Services

An electrical emergency can be loosely defined as an unexpected or dangerous situation related to electric systems or devices that poses a safety risk. Malfunctioning appliances, power outages, flickering lights, burning smells, or sparking outlets could all potentially constitute an electrical emergency. In such circumstances, emergency electrician services are invaluable, offering prompt response, on-the-spot trouble-shooting, and decisive action to rectify the issue and prevent escalation.

Safety Measures and Precautions

In an electrical emergency, safety remains paramount. Immediate precautions include turning off power sources and avoiding contact with water. It may even be necessary to evacuate the premises when advised by experts. Preventing emergencies through regular maintenance, safety inspections and adhering to general electrical safety guidelines also go a long way in ensuring household and business safety.

When should I call an emergency electrician?

You should call an emergency electrician when you encounter situations such as power outages, electrical shocks, burning smells from outlets, or sparking wires. Any electrical issue that poses an immediate safety risk should prompt a call to an emergency electrician.

How do I know if my situation qualifies as an electrical emergency?

Answer: Any electrical issue that presents an immediate safety risk or disrupts essential functions in your home or business can be considered an electrical emergency. Signs of electrical emergencies include power outages affecting multiple areas, electrical shocks, burning odours, and sparking outlets or wires.
